> Hi, I thought that it would make sense to fix this before official
> release. Terminfo has just recently started to support capabilites for
> detecting 24-bit terminals.

It's too late to make incompatible changes on the emacs-26 branch.

I actually don't understand the motivation for the change.  Did the
method we use now stop working in the recent versions of terminfo, and
the "RGB" and "setaf"/"setab" replace "setf24"/"setb24" we use in the
current code?  Or are the new attributes supported in addition to the
old ones?  If the latter, why do we need to change anything?  And if
the former, I think we want to support both, not just the new
replacements.
